[QUOTE="anonymous, post: 5840814"]I think the FDA/ Compliance would like to hear about OraPharma's business strategies. I think a certain bank got in trouble for doing similar tactics. The pressure and expectations to sell NeutraSal are unrealistic and unethical. They failed to deliver the rinse 3 different times and then launched it with little warning and with expectations that were never sustained in the past. Talk about setting reps up for failure. I've heard of reps signing themselves and family members up for scripts because of pressure from upper managment. Horrible. I'd like an audit to see how many reps have done this and were the people actually patients of record for that doctor? I also like when confronted with how the #1 sales rep had got so many scripts, that managment said it was just hard work so need for him to share best practices to the rest of the sales force. I smell BS. Upper managment knows they are asking way too much because they screwed up so much in the past and now we have to pick up the pieces. I was told to bribe accounts to get scripts. Do whatever it takes!!! Arestin is also typical Price gouging that Valeant is know for and illegally billing out a dental procedure as a script through patients pharmacy benefits. Quote - we are flying under the radar with pharmacy companies till we get caught. Wow! I think it's about time Valeants feet are held to the fire and start doing what's best for patients instead of their greed running us into the ground. They haven't been doing the right thing for years and with an old sales rep at the helm, we are doomed. We need leadership fast!!![/QUOTE]
